Remarks:
| (1) | The reporting person is filing this Amendment to the Form 144 originally filed on August 27, 2019 (“Original Form 144”) in order to reflect that any sales will occur under a Rule 10b5-1 trading plan and change the date of approximate sale. The reporting person filed the Original Form 144 for the proposed sale of the 2,203 shares between August 30, 2019 and August 30, 2020, however, none of the shares have been sold as of the date of this Amendment. On September 4, 2019, the reporting person entered into a Rule 10b5-1 trading plan with LPL Financial LLC, which contemplates the sale of up to 2,203 shares of the Issuer’s common stock from September 8, 2019 to September 8, 2020 under the parameters set forth in the plan. |
| (2) | Based on closing market price of $29.95 on September 5, 2019. |
| (3) | Any sales by the reporting person will occur under the terms of a Rule 10b5-1 trading plan, which contemplates the sale of up to 2,203 shares of the Issuer’s common stock from September 8, 2019 to September 8, 2020 under certain specified conditions. |
